Margin Reporting Transparency

Transparency

Margin reporting transparency within cryptocurrency, options, and derivatives markets denotes the standardized disclosure of positions and associated margin requirements to regulatory bodies and, increasingly, to central counterparties (CCPs). This practice aims to mitigate systemic risk by providing a clearer view of aggregated exposures and potential vulnerabilities across the financial system, particularly concerning leveraged positions. Effective implementation relies on granular data reporting, encompassing details on collateral posted, margin calls, and the underlying assets supporting derivative contracts, facilitating proactive risk management.
